    NACOSS awards Programos as most innovative and supportive ICT company

    The Executive Council Members of the National Association of Computer Science Students (NACOSS), today awarded Programos Software Group the most innovative and supportive Information and Communications Technology company in Nigeria.

    Presenting the award to Programos at the company’s corporate headquarters in Lagos, Comrade Okoro Emeka Louis, the National Public Relations officer of NACOSS said the award is a recognition of various efforts Programos has put in place to groom the youths, especially Nigerian students in the country.

    “We are awarding Programos Software Group the most innovative and supportive Information and Communications Technology company in Nigeria today because there are clear facts and pictures of various programmes Programos has done to groom the Nigerian youths in the area of Information and Communications Technology,” he said.

    He noted that Programos is not just doing the mere speaking, but is also doing the practical aspect of it with the full empowerment of the youths, which has helped some to become enterprenuer and are creating jobs for other youths.

    Responding, an elated Chief Executive Officer of Programos Software, Mr. Emmanuel Amos said he is happy to be recognised yet challenged to do more to empower the youths, who most of the time don’t know how to approach the future after school.

    He urged other organizations to come to the aid of Nigerian Students given that the current global trends in technologies now require Extracurriculum exposures into the future of education, work, health, transport, etc, and general e-content areas that can catalyze the increase in their true academic values as they leave school.

    “Despite so much economic confusion, students have been charged to stay focused and still sacrifice as much as possible in self development as there are brand new opportunities emerging in the technology sector that only the ‘patient dog will eat the fattest bone’!,” he asserted.
